We report the results of a search for pair production of doubly charged Higgs bosons via pp-bar→H(++)H(−−)X→μ(+)μ(+)μ(−)μ(−)X at s√=1.96 TeV. We use a data set corresponding to an integrated luminosity of 1.1 fb(−1) collected from 2002 to 2006 by the D0 detector at the Fermilab Tevatron Collider. In the absence of an excess above the standard model background, lower mass limits of M(H(±±)(L))>150 GeV/c(2) and M(H(±±)(R))>127 GeV/c(2) at 95% C.L. are set, respectively, for left-handed and right-handed doubly charged Higgs bosons assuming a 100% branching ratio into muons.
